The deck boards run parallel to the house, in the 20 ... Web30 dec. 2024 · The post size is determined by the load area and deck height. In this case, the beams are 10 feet apart (ledger to beam = 10 feet) and the distance between the posts is 12 feet. Our load area is 10 x 12 = 120 feet and according to the chart, we need 6-by-6 posts regardless of how high the deck is. Assuming a minimum soil bearing capacity of 1,500 psf, 8-inch-diameter concrete piers bearing on square footings measuring 2 feet on a side and 9 to 11 inches thick are … Web4 nov. 2024 · Isolated footings describe a foundation type that supports a post or column that is not part of a continuous footing. The footing is “isolated”, and therefore it is straight-forward to calculate the load capacity of this footing type because there is no shared weight. All the weight carried by one post is transferred to one footing.

Web20 apr. 2024 · Step 1: Determine Your Deck’s Square Footage. The first step for answering “how to calculate how much decking I need” is to determine your deck’s square footage, or area, by taking the length of your deck times the width (L x W). EXAMPLE: For a deck that is 16 feet long and 12 feet wide, multiply 16 by 12. This gives you 192 square feet ...
